Views about environmental regulation among adults who say that right or wrong depends on the situation by religious denomination (2014) Switch to: Religious denomination among adults who say that right or wrong depends on the situation by views about environmental protection

% of adults who say that right or wrong depends on the situation who say…

Religious denominationStricter environmental laws and regulations cost too many jobs and hurt the economyStricter environmental laws and regulations are worth the costNeither/both equallyDon't knowSample size
American Baptist Churches USA36%61%2%2%303
Assemblies of God39%54%1%6%182
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ints45%53%2%< 1%252
Churches of Christ46%48%2%4%244
Episcopal Church24%71%2%3%332
Evangelical Lutheran Church in America (ELCA)31%66%2%1%418
Independent Baptist (Evangelical Trad.)46%52%2%1%375
Interdenominational (Evangelical Trad.)29%67%3%1%101
Interdenominational (Mainline Trad.)13%84%3%< 1%104
Lutheran Church-Missouri Synod32%64%2%3%233
National Baptist Convention28%66%2%4%309
Nondenominational evangelical34%59%4%3%201
Nothing in particular (religion important)35%59%3%3%1,407
Nothing in particular (religion not important)25%71%2%2%2,343
Presbyterian Church (USA)33%63%2%3%279
Southern Baptist Convention43%52%2%3%813
Spiritual but not religious22%60%8%10%101
Unitarian7%91%1%< 1%134
United Church of Christ23%74%1%2%167
United Methodist Church35%60%2%2%986
